Airpac Bukom adds Doosan compressors to fleet

By Murray Pollok28 January 2009

Airpac Bukom Oilfield Services, the oil and gas rental division of UK rental group Vp plc, has placed a multi-million euro order with Doosan Infracore Portable Power for a new fleet of Ingersoll Rand Rigsafe portable compressors.

The investment expands the company's equipment rental fleet to support a growing market for well test and high pressure pipeline operations worldwide. The order comprises Ingersoll Rand 9/270 Rigsafe air compressors supplying 28 m3/min at 8.6 bar. The units will primarily used on well test contracts in Africa and South America.

Airpac Bukom has also invested heavily in high pressure XHP1070 Rigsafe air compressors from Doosan Infracore Portable Power. The rental company's Singapore base, for example, has recently supplied Weatherford with 10 of the new XHP1070 units and dryers for a 7 month testing contract in the Fujian Province of the People's Republic of China.

The company, which has a fleet of 400 air compressors, is based in the UK where it started renting equipment to the North Sea over 30 years ago, but now operates a number of rental hubs worldwide, including Australia, the Middle East and Latin America.

Airpac previously had an onshore rental operation, but sold that to Australia's Coates Hire in 2002.
